Julgue o item, relativos à programação orientada a objetos ...
Julgue o item, relativos à programação orientada a objetos (POO).
Na POO, o domínio pode ser definido como o conjunto
de conceitos que representam os aspectos
insignificantes de um determinado problema, o qual se
está tentando resolver.
Gabarito comentado
Confira o gabarito comentado por um dos nossos professores
Alternativa correta: E - Errado
Na Programação Orientada a Objetos (POO), o termo domínio é usado de uma maneira bastante específica. Ele se refere ao conjunto de conceitos significativos que representam os aspectos importantes e relevantes de um determinado problema que está sendo modelado ou resolvido por meio do software.
O que faz a alternativa ser incorreta é a palavra "insignificantes". Em um domínio, buscamos abstrair e modelar as características e comportamentos que são essenciais para a compreensão e a solução do problema, e não os que são irrelevantes. Portanto, é crucial para quem trabalha com POO identificar e modelar esses aspectos significativos para criar um design eficiente e uma estrutura de código que represente bem o problema em questão.
Para resolver esta questão, é necessário compreender o conceito de domínio dentro da POO e reconhecer que a modelagem orientada a objetos envolve a identificação dos conceitos chave que deverão ser representados no sistema como classes, atributos, métodos e relações. O erro na assertiva está na interpretação equivocada do que é considerado relevante no contexto do domínio de um problema.
Clique para visualizar este gabarito
Visualize o gabarito desta questão clicando no botão abaixo
Comentários
Veja os comentários dos nossos alunos
Esse "insignificante" matou a questão para mim.
::::::::::::::::Indo mais fundo::::::::::::::::
- Domínio pode ser visto como uma estrutura de classificação de elementos correlatos
- Normalmente, sistemas OO tem suas classes em um dos seguintes domínios: – Domínio de aplicação – Domínio de negócio – Domínio de arquitetura – Domínio de base
- Cada classe de um sistema OO devem pertencer a um único domínio para ser coesa
Referência: Princípio de POO (Programação Orientada a Objetos). Disponível em:
<http://www.ic.uff.br/~viviane.silva/2010.1/es1/util/aula11_a.pdf>
::::::::::::::::::::::::::::::::::::::::::::::::::::::::::
GABARITO ERRADO
Gabarito: ERRADO
Julgue o item a seguir, relativos à programação orientada a objetos (POO).
Na POO, o domínio pode ser definido como o conjunto de conceitos que representam os aspectos insignificantes de um determinado problema, o qual se está tentando resolver.
Questãozinha marota da banca. Ela está ERRADA por causa da palavra "insignificantes": devemos trocá-la por significantes. Um domínio, em POO, é uma descrição de tudo aquilo que envolve um determinado problema que se deseja resolver. Por exemplo, em um aplicativo na Web que faz transações bancárias, o domínio pode englobar os casos de uso do sistema (as diferentes maneiras do usuário interagir com aquele sistema) e também a sua descrição através de diagramas (de casos de uso, classes, objetos e etc) e especificações formais.
Clique para visualizar este comentário
Visualize os comentários desta questão clicando no botão abaixo